Margaret “Peg” Altomari, of North Kingstown, passed away on February 22, 2019 surrounded by her loving family, after a nine month battle with pancreatic cancer.
She was the loving mother of beloved daughter Stephanie Michelle Altomari Cavanagh and mother in law of Robert Cavanagh, Jr. She also leaves behind her precious granddaughter, Caroline Brooke Cavanagh, whom she adored. She was the daughter of the late Frank J. Parisi and Josephine (Zanni) Parisi. She was the loving older sister to twins, Joan (Parisi) Bernhardt and Jean (Parisi) Acciardo. She also leaves behind 5 nieces and nephews and 6 great nieces and nephews.
Peg worked for the State of Rhode Island for 33 years. Shortly after retirement from the State she was employed as a part time receptionist at St. Elizabeth Home, East Greenwich for 15 years, until she became ill. She leaves behind residents who became friends through the years. Peg was also a member in good standing of Alcoholics Anonymous for the past 20 years. She was very proud of this achievement.
Peg adored her family, especially Stephanie and Caroline. She also loved her friends in A.A. and would like to thank all her A.A. friends and family who prayed for her for many months. She greatly appreciated their out pouring of support and affection.
Funeral Service Friday, March 1 st at 6:00pm at the Hill Funeral Home, 822 Main St., East Greenwich. Visitation prior to the service 4-6pm. In lieu of flowers, donations may be made to the American Cancer Society.
